January 27th, 2012Everybody is searching for ways to save money these days. Were you aware when you bundel your car and home insurance you can save up to 30% for your yearly insurance premiums? You already know I have heard the same assurance made by so many insurance companies, so often, I decided to actually give them a call.
I picked up my phone and started to call the big Insurance Carriers, inquiring about how much cash can I actually save a year by bundling my insurance policies? My existing auto insurance plus, house insurance policies (with earthquake insurance and Flood protection) is around $2900 a yr, so my overall savings ought to be around $870 dollars.
So the 1st big carrier I called only managed to save me around $330. The second was somewhat better roughly $350, and the third was the worst of the 3, merely saving me $180 a year. When I received these “Whopping” insurance savings, they were not even close to the thirty % advertised. Knowing this I asked them all; “Your advertisements state that I could reward yourself with a “Huge” insurance savings discount by bundling insurance protection with you”. All of them answered with the exact same cookie cutter answer “Sir the advertising campaign says…you could save up to 30%, not that you’re going to save 30%”.
So being a fairly level headed person I think, fair enough commercials is usually a bit elusive to the truth so I actually can’t whine about it. After that I tried a couple of smaller local insurance companies. You know the independent insurance companies not fixed to just one insurance service provider. Now these independents got me way closer to the 30% and one company got me more than the thirty percent insurance savings discounts, all these advertisements assure. These “non captive” insurance agents quoted myself starting $585 – $930 dollars in savings a yr naturally I signed with the local independent insurance agency saving myself $930 a yr. And if you think about it, the money I saved by signing to this local agency will pay for my auto and a part of my flood insurance coverage, as well as I only get one statement for both insurance plans. Therefore I suppose all those commercials promising “BIG” insurance saving are true…provided that you use a local independent insurance agency.
